# Break-Glass: Catalog Cache Invalidation

Scope: the Pinrow product catalog at Veldstone Retail. If stale prices persist after a purge and the Hollowmere invalidation queue is wedged, use break-glass to flush the edge tier directly. Contractors: get verbal sign-off from the catalog lead first. Steps: open the Hollowmere admin shell, select emergency-flush, confirm the tenant, and run it once — repeated flushes thrash the origin. Access is logged and expires after 20 minutes. Unseal the admin shell with the passphrase below.

recovery phrase for kahop-tajog: istix-casvan

MEMO — Sales Leads Only

Effective next quarter, legacy Varntide customers move to current list pricing. No grandfathering beyond March. Increase averages 12%. Scripts and FAQ land Friday; do not discuss before then. Escalations go to Dremel Koss, not regional reps. Rationale for the timing is below.

management briefing: Project Ulavan slips by two quarters because of the staffing delay.

# Review notes: this service builds puzzle grids from the curated
# wordlist service and signs published puzzles before distribution.
# All variables below are non-sensitive tuning values: grid size
# caps, symmetry mode, dictionary refresh interval, and log level.
# The one sensitive value is the wordlist service credential, which
# must never be committed; it is injected at deploy time and scoped
# read-only. For local review builds only, it may be set directly
# in this file on the line that follows:

env line for fafof-fahag: LEDGER_TOKEN5=f8790

## StormRelay Fan-Out: Contacts

The StormRelay fan-out service distributes severe-weather alerts to regional subscriber queues. If fan-out latency exceeds the two-minute budget, or a regional queue stalls, do not restart workers blindly; check the dedupe cache first. For escalations beyond the on-call rotation, reach the Galepoint platform team directly at the address below.

pager mailbox: silael.sorwyn.tamius@zemvarsys.corp